Prosetter: Higher Productivity Thanks to Extended Automation - Heidelberg Adds Multi Cassette Loader to Violet Platesetter and Enhances Integration in the Printroom

04/01/2004


At drupa 2004, Heidelberger Druckmaschinen AG (Heidelberg) will be adding a further option - the Multi Cassette Loader - to its Prosetter range of violet platesetters.

This new option means a Prosetter system can now image up to four different plate formats over several hours without changing cassettes. Thanks to the significantly reduced makeready times for format changes, this new loader module increases the productivity of the overall configuration. The Multi Cassette Loader can be retrofitted to existing systems on site in just a few hours. The integration of prepress into the printroom is also enhanced, thanks to a new, direct control link for plate production from the Prinect CP2000 Center.

Modularity promotes growth
The entire Prosetter range is of modular design and geared to growth. Consequently, you can add a Single Cassette Loader or Multi Cassette Loader to the basic units at any time, thereby turning them into fully automatic systems. The manual Prosetter images up to 24 silver halide or photopolymer plates per hour. For fully automatic and more efficient production, the Single Cassette Loader (SCL) is docked onto the Prosetter. The Single Cassette Loader now performs the loading operation, then transports the imaged plate to the online processor for development via an integrated conveyor. To ensure greater flexibility with regard to formats or increased plate requirements, the system can now be augmented by the new Multi Cassette Loader. This consists of the SCL and a Multi Cassette Container holding up to four cassettes. Each cassette can be loaded with up to 150 plates. The Multi Cassette Loader therefore holds a total of up to 600 printing plates ready for fully automated plate production. A software-controlled elevator system in the Multi Cassette Container automatically loads the appropriate cassette for the required plate format into the SCL. Thanks to the extremely straightforward installation procedure, existing systems can also be retrofitted with this new system on site in a very short time, giving the customer more flexibility to handle increasingly demanding jobs. The Prosetter, together with the Single or Multi Cassette Loader, is a light-safe system and can therefore also be used in daylight conditions. The first Multi Cassette Loaders will be dispatched in the fall of this year.

Plate On Demand for the printroom
The new "Plate On Demand" function integrates the Prosetter even more directly into the printroom. To use this function, the operator of the Prinect CP2000 Center does not need any prior knowledge of the prepress processes. He simply selects the required job on his touchscreen. At the press of a button, he then starts plate imaging for the required color separation or the entire job directly via the CtP device. This direct control of the plate production is particularly useful during a night shift or for post-production of a printing plate. The prepress operator prepares the jobs as before, the press operator can then look at the job list and if necessary change the order of the jobs later on or select to go directly to the imaging stage by pressing a button on the CP2000 Center. This means the capacity utilization in the printroom determines plate production from the outset rather than vice versa. The "Plate On Demand" function will be available at the end of the year. Users must have Prinect MetaDimension Version 5.0 and enable the Preset Link option in the Prinect CP2000 Center Version 41 or Prinect Print Center.
